Here’s how it works. Simply choose the contact lenses you want (make, type, strength, etc), add any accessories (like cleaning solutions) that you need, fax off your prescription to 1-800-contacts and they’ll ship your order to your door the same business day.

Now, of course many of us don’t have access to a fax machine, so if you can’t, or prefer not to, fax your prescription, 1-800-Contact will call your doctor directly to confirm your details, and then they’ll send out your order. That adds a little time to the order processing delay, but there’s no charge to you, and the convenience is pretty darn sweet.

When you’ve placed your order, you’ll get an email telling you that it’s confirmed, then you’ll get another to let you know your order has been shipped. For most people in the US, that means your contact lenses are at your door within five days, and in their original manufacturer packaging.

1-800-Contacts always has rebate discounts going on, from $40 off Acuvue contact lenses, to $40 off Biomedics, Optimedics, O2 Optix, and Focus contacts, to a whopping $60 off Focus DAILIES. And that’s just a small sampling of the discounts on offer every day of our trial run.

What we really like about the 1-800-Contacts website is that they don’t just sell lenses. If you need an eye exam, they’ll set up an appointment for you at an optometrist nearby. Just put your phone number into the system and a 1-800-Contacts rep will call you, get your details, and set you up with an appointment close to your home - at a discounted rate.

Never been to an eye doctor before? The website lists an abundant variety of information about what to expect, what products are popular, and information about the eye itself so you know what to be on the look out for if things are wrong.
